Assisted Living Costs in Greensboro, NC
Understanding costs helps families budget and compare communities fairly. Below are estimated ranges for the Greensboro metro area.
| Care Type | Monthly Cost Range |
|---|---|
| Assisted Living (base) | $3,500 – $4,300/mo |
| Memory Care | $4,700 – $5,700/mo |
| Studio / Shared Room | $3,100 – $3,900/mo |
| One-Bedroom Private | $3,900 – $5,100/mo |
| Community / Move-In Fee | $1,000 – $5,000 one-time |
Estimates for Greensboro metro area. Request an all-in quote after care assessment.

Medicaid for Assisted Living in Greensboro
North Carolina program: NC CAP / Medicaid Innovations Waiver. Screening limits in Greensboro use statewide rules — income ~$2,829/mo, assets ~$2,000.
North Carolina helpline: 1-800-662-7030
- • Medicaid waiver programs in North Carolina may cover care services in participating Greensboro communities.
- • Room and board in assisted living is typically still private pay — waivers often cover care hours only.
- • The Greensboro metro has 38 licensed communities — ask each if they accept NC CAP / Medicaid Innovations Waiver.

Does Medicare pay for assisted living in Greensboro, NC?▾
Medicare does not cover long-term assisted living room and board in North Carolina. Medicaid waiver programs may help eligible residents with care costs. See our paying for care guide for details.
